从图像到理解机器视觉软件解析数据价值
机器视觉软件概述
机器视觉软件是一种利用计算机算法来分析和解释图像或视频中的信息的技术。它结合了计算机视觉、模式识别、人工智能等多个领域的知识,旨在帮助企业和个人自动化处理图像数据,从而提高工作效率和决策质量。
数据采集与预处理
在使用机器视觉软件之前,首先需要通过相机或其他设备对场景进行数据采集。这部分工作通常涉及到光照控制、角度调整以及避免遮挡等因素。采集到的原始数据往往含有杂音,如噪声或者不相关的信息,这些都需要经过预处理以去除干扰并提取出有用的特征。
特征提取与模型训练
预处理后的图像数据将被送入特征提取环节。在这个阶段,算法会寻找图像中能够代表其内容的关键点,如边缘、角点或者颜色分布等。这些特征是后续分类过程中的基础。
分类与目标检测
提取出的特征将用于训练分类模型,使得系统能够根据历史学习经验对新的输入进行判断。如果是目标检测任务,则还需设计一个区域建议网络(RPN)来生成候选框,然后进一步精细化这些框以确定物体的位置和大小。
解析与理解
经过上述步骤后,系统就能开始对输入的图片进行深层次解析。例如,在工业监控中,可以用来检查零件是否合格;在医疗影像分析中,可以用来诊断疾病;在安防领域,可以用来实时监测并识别潜在威胁。而对于更复杂的情境,比如情感分析或者意图识别,需要结合自然语言处理技术,以获取更丰富的人类行为理解。
应用场景探讨
智能制造:通过实时监控生产线上的零件状态,确保产品质量。
自动驾驶:实现车辆之间无人驾驶,并且适应各种交通环境。
安全监控:有效地扫描出可能威胁的人脸或异常行为。
未来的发展趋势
随着深度学习技术不断进步,我们可以期待未来更多基于大规模数据库训练得到优化性能卓越的人工智能模型被应用于现有的商业解决方案。此外,更强大的硬件支持也将推动这一领域向前发展,为用户提供更加高效便捷的一站式服务解决方案。